Avoidance of violence is at the heart of Aikido. Children learn not how to fight, but how to cooperate; how to resolve conflict in a positive way; how to make friends and avoid making enemies. They learn self-defense, but more importantly they learn self-confidence and self-respect.
Class
We have two youth classes a week as regular schedule. Victor Williams sensei regularly teaches youth class every Wednesday and Sunday. Approximately 10 children attend training. Training starts from stretching, rolling (UKEMI), pair practice of technique, group work, game. Parents are welcome to observe class.
Summer Camp
In August, Aikido Summer Camp is held for a week. Children will enjoy activities include Aikido, Japanese sword, yoga and games.
Grading
We have testing three times a year. Every children is graded as they developed technique.
